Details

The "Jharkhand Krishi Rin Mafi Yojana" was launched by the Department of Agriculture, Animal Husbandry & Cooperative, Government of Jharkhand on 7th January 2021, to provide relief from the debt burden to short-term agricultural loan holders in the state. Under this scheme, outstanding loan amounts of up to ₹50,000/- in standard crop loan outstanding accounts as of 31st March 2020, will be waived. Standard crop loan borrowers as of 31st March 2020, will be eligible to avail the benefits of this scheme.
The main objectives of the scheme are as follows:

  • To improve the loan eligibility of crop loan holders.
  • To ensure receipt of new crop loan.
  • To stop the migration of farming communities.
  • To strengthen the agricultural economy.

Salient features of the scheme:

  • Details of standard KCC loans covered under Aadhaar card and ration card are being uploaded by the bank on the loan waiver portal.
  • The scheme will be implemented online through the web portal. This will minimize contact between the applicant and officials.
  • Identification of correct beneficiaries using the Aadhaar number of the applicant and paperless application process.
  • Easy online application process.
  • The process of receiving applications through the Common Service Centre and Banks so as to provide scheme facilities to the applicants near their homes.
  • Redressal of grievances of applicants through online mode.

  1. Under this scheme, outstanding loan amounts of up to ₹50,000/- in standard crop loan outstanding accounts as of 31st March 2020, will be waived.

Note: Repayment of outstanding loan through DBT.

Eligibility

  1. The applicant should be a permanent resident of Jharkhand.
  2. The age of the farmer should be more than 18 years.
  3. The applicant should be a farmer who self-cultivates their land or cultivates leased land.
  4. The applicant should be a small or marginal farmer who has availed of the loan through the Kisan Credit Card.
  5. The farmer should have a valid Aadhaar number.
  6. The applicant should be a valid ration card holder.
  7. The applicant should be a Kisan Credit Card holder.
  8. The applicant should be a short-term crop loan holder.
  9. The crop loan should be issued by a recognized bank located in Jharkhand.
  10. The family of the deceased debtor is also eligible under the scheme.
  11. The applicant should have a standard crop loan account.
  12. Only one member per family holding a crop loan will be eligible.
  13. This scheme will be voluntary for all crop loan holders.

Note: The applicant has to pay ₹1/- only for the application.
Eligibility for banks, criteria, determining outstanding loans and deadlines, eligible loan accounts, and exceptions:

  • Qualified Banks - Commercial Banks, Scheduled Co-operative Banks and Rural Banks
  • Qualifying Loan - Short-Term Crop Loan
  • Eligible period for disbursement - Upto 31.03.2020
  • Qualifying Loan Account - Single & Joint
  • Loans taken for crop diseases

Exclusions

The following category of borrowers will not be eligible to join this scheme:-

  1. Former and present members of Rajya Sabha/Lok Sabha/Legislative Assembly/ Former or present Minister of State Government/Current Chairman of Municipal Bodies / Current Chairman of District Council.
  2. All serving or retired officers and employees of Central or State Government, Departments, and their regional units “Ministries/PSEs and attached offices of State Government, autonomous institutions under the Government, and regular employees of local bodies (except Multitasking Staff / Group-IV / Group-D employees)
  3. All Superannuated/Retired pensioners whose monthly pension is ₹10,000/- or more. (Except Multitasking Staff/Group-IV/Group-D personnel)
  4. All persons who paid income tax in the last assessment year.
  5. Professionals like all registered doctors, engineers, lawyers, chartered accountants, and architects who are practicing.

Application Process

Online

Step 1: Visit the "Jharkhand Krishi Rin Mafi Yojana" official website to apply for scheme benefits.
Step 2: On the home page, click on 'Beneficiary Registration' and then enter your Aadhaar Number.
Step 3: Your basic information, such as name and loan amount, will be displayed upon entering your Aadhaar number.
Step 4: Enter your ration card number.
Step 5: Click on the name under which the loan is registered.
Step 6: Review all displayed information carefully and click "Submit".
Step 7: Authenticate your Aadhaar to verify your identity.
Step 8: Proceed to make the application fee payment.
Step 9: After successful payment, receive a confirmation slip for your application.

Online - via CSC

The eligible applicant will have to follow the following procedures to avail the benefits of this scheme:-
Step 1: To apply for this scheme, the eligible applicant has to visit the Common Service Centers (CSCs)/Bank Branch with a copy of his/her Aadhaar Card and Ration Card.
Step 2: CSC Bank will help the applicant to view their outstanding loan amount and other details using their Aadhaar number on the scheme portal.
Step 3: The applicant will have to provide his/her mobile number and copy of Aadhaar and Ration Card for uploading on the scheme portal.
Step 4: Once the applicant confirms the outstanding details, he/she has to authenticate his application through e-KYC.
Step 5: Once the applicant confirms his/her details through e-KYC, his/her application will be automatically submitted to the scheme portal for further verification and processing.
Step 6: The applicant will receive a token number or reference number upon successful submission of his/her application. This can also be used for future reference.
Step 7: The applicant has to pay ₹1/- only for the application.
Step 8: The applicant can also receive the confirmation message of application submission on his/her mobile number.
Step 9: The applicant can be given a receipt for fee payment at the CSC centre.

How and who can avail the benefits of the scheme?

The outstanding amount up to ₹50,000/- in the standard crop loan accounts till March 31, 2020 is being waived after the bank uploads the details of Standard KCC LOAN covered under Aadhar Card and Ration Card on the loan waiver portal.

E-KYC has been completed successfully, but what should be done if ₹1 token is not generated?

First of all go to the DNO of your area and get your e-KYC cancelled, then do your e-KYC again and get a token of ₹1.

If a person's name is in the loan waiver list, but e-KYC cannot be done due to his/her death, what should be done in such a case?

This matter is still under consideration.

I have changed my digital signature and registered it, still it is not logging in.

There are two possible causes for this problem: a) Your system is not reading your digital signature token correctly. b) Your device may not be plugged in correctly, so please remove your device and try again.

When searching my UID number, it shows someone else's data, what should I do?

You will have to contact your respective bank and get your documents updated.

What to do, when I am trying to generate Acknowledgement (Pawti) receipt and I have to pay a rupee, it shows a (payment gateway related) error/UID gateway related error?

This error is not related to our web portal; these are Third Party integrated API related issues. Please wait for a while or try again after some time. Even after this, if the problem persists and Acknowledgement (Pawti) receipt is not generated, then go to the DNO of your area and cancel your e-KYC and get e-KYC done again.

What should I do if my Aadhaar number search shows "No Record Found"?

This message is related to your respective bank, so please contact your respective bank and check whether they have uploaded your data or not.

While giving my ration card number and trying to proceed, it shows someone has already applied with the given ration card number?

This means that a member of your family may have already applied with this ration card number. If not, you can contact the DNO(DAO) of your area and give them this information.
